Case Details

  • Case name: Special Leave Petition (Criminal) Diary No.65/2026
  • Parties: Assistant Director & ANR (Petitioner) vs R K M POWERGEN PRIVATE LIMITED (Respondent)
  • Court/Authority: Supreme Court of India
  • Order/Diary No.: IA No. 34874/2026 (condonation of delay)
  • Date of order: 29-05-2026
  • Period of violation/dispute: Not specified

Parties Involved

  • Petitioners: Assistant Director & ANR (represented by counsel Anil Kaushik, A.S.G.; Pranjal Singh, Adv.; Zoheb Hussain, Adv.; Arkaj Kumar, Adv.; Prashant Singh‑ii, Adv.; Rajeshwari Shankar, Adv.; Arvind Kumar Sharma, AOR)
  • Respondent: R K M POWERGEN PRIVATE LIMITED
  • Court: Hon’ble Justices Dipankar Datta and Satish Chandra Sharma
  • Additional Solicitor General: Mr. Anil Kaushik (recorded statement)

Issues / Allegations / Violations

  • Petition sought condonation of delay in filing IA No. 34874/2026.
  • Additional documents were filed on 03.03.2026 but were found to have defects.

Findings & Observations

  • The Court observed that the delay in filing could be condoned.
  • Noted the presence of defects in the additional documents filed on 03.03.2026.

Penalties / Settlements / Directions

  • No monetary penalty imposed.
  • Directions issued:

1. Delay condoned.

2. Issue notice to the respondent.

3. Tag the matter with SLP (C) Diary No.66191/2025.

4. Record statement of Additional Solicitor General regarding defective documents.

5. Allow respondent to cure the defects.

Corrective Actions & Future Obligations

  • Respondent must cure the identified defects in the documents filed on 03.03.2026.
  • Await further notice from the Court after curing defects.

Final Ruling & Enforcement

  • The Supreme Court order dated 29‑05‑2026 condones the filing delay, issues notice, tags the case, and mandates curing of document defects. Enforcement will proceed upon compliance.
